Fireplace Shelves Installation in Frederick, MD
Fireplace shelves installation services involve adding functional and decorative shelves above a fireplace to enhance the aesthetic appeal and provide practical storage or display space. These projects can range from simple floating shelves to more elaborate built-in units, accommodating various styles and materials such as wood, stone, or metal. Homeowners often request this service to personalize their living spaces, display cherished items, or create a focal point in the room that complements existing decor.
Before requesting fireplace shelves installation, property owners typically want to understand the available options for materials, design styles, and the best placement for both safety and visual balance. It’s also helpful to consider the size and weight of the shelves, especially in relation to the fireplace’s structure and heat output. Proper planning ensures the shelves are both visually appealing and securely installed, making them a functional addition to the living space.

Fireplace Shelves Installation Questions
What materials are typically used for fireplace shelves? Common options include wood, marble, and stone, offering a range of styles and durability.
Can fireplace shelves be customized to fit specific spaces? Yes, shelves can be tailored to match the dimensions and design preferences of a fireplace area.
Are there any style considerations for fireplace shelves? Shelves can complement various interior styles, from traditional to modern, enhancing the overall look.
What is the typical process for installing a fireplace shelf? The process involves measuring, selecting materials, and securely mounting the shelf to ensure stability and safety.
